Details
The SAKHI NIWAS YOJNA aims to provide safe and convenient residential accommodation for working women in both urban and rural areas. The scheme also focuses on creating employment opportunities for women and includes day care facilities for their children wherever possible.
Benefits
- Provides accommodation facilities for working women
- Supports women pursuing higher education or training
- Non-discriminatory access to services
Eligibility
This scheme is applicable to all women, regardless of profession, education, or social and economic standards. There are no individual or family income limits.

Application Process
Online
Applications can be submitted on plain paper to the implementing agency. Forms are available from the implementing agency. For more details, visit the Department's website.
